* * @extends MultiplePcreFilterIterator */ class FilenameFilterIterator extends MultiplePcreFilterIterator { /** * Filters the iterator values. * * @return bool */ #[\ReturnTypeWillChange] public function accept() { return $this->isAccepted($this->current()->getFilename()); } /** * Converts glob to regexp. * * PCRE patterns are left unchanged. * Glob strings are transformed with Glob::toRegex(). * * @param string $str Pattern: glob or regexp * * @return string */ protected function toRegex(string $str) { return $this->isRegex($str) ? $str : Glob::toRegex($str); } } __halt_compiler();----SIGNATURE:----L0pbgIa9HFSa5DaOCpIgZk9eQNYQMtzqQ9FugU/9w3WSvq4AEStJ1tabeKEO4S4AQeAj82YCCDIEVVlbCaUQWKZcMXNCeVTld1dJ6kBe2x1ClAMo6xqUKxkjuvOMxnIAZlXi23FZwehqT2ZKh0xYyABiUBKDcFwBxIVpNvnlHPnEEkgu/ktfiCC7qYrMjAWEeucHzspBrmURQNFRkzQ6KUK6tSFoshZbj1yBBYAtnsOkKPONt9uWkOdfTUdLuhXvUrn1h0v3RXJbNMFAESwLFgDAiMrQeZOEDkmaqi2Rekk+n5hCm8CYQPAffumBZNW9XMOKs9B0MjIP+5JUTzHL2cfy5aK2NcjFN/P0T8OyafJ71d5Lf+kLyJWwEg+0FhcHZTPkOIKMh4bhq29iTRMYk78dPYIgqxrYPx1AJO1ryC8YwBYlasaMMksTza2uzkTp+Gkui7PoNiMozd1EtHhAGB9TvWr57uN59MIv+MGl0B0OPlrLBpEPymuPQKStXxSVBdq1AcKlmMBOROrk7FQtXUuJ2vKMZrJqE8T9YtcfbqPFqJaGPmy17OeSYNBzgEnIUl0XbkVFID5RFRScvzrwrbpDYwK8OifLxJAmNDH4pWm2GdkJ9kKsKJA+9AjTep+oU0lTX3JcyKfwPqQGQgEOqpFthwHMMwZNwYKAgZQYJLQ=----ATTACHMENT:----NDcyOTQ3Njc4MTI2MjI0OCAzNDU0MTE1NDc0MjUwNDggNjI0NzI3MzQ5MDgzMzI3Mg==